SUBROUTINE mp_iallgatherv_iv2(msgout, msgin, rcount, rdispl, gid, request)
!! Gathers vector data from all processes and all processes receive the
!! same data
!!
!! Data size
!! Processes can send different-sized data
!!
!! Ranks
!! The last rank counts the processes
!!
!! Offsets
!! Offsets are from 0
!!
!! MPI mapping
!! mpi_allgather
INTEGER(KIND=int_4), CONTIGUOUS, INTENT(IN) :: msgout(:)
!! Rank-1 data to send
INTEGER(KIND=int_4), CONTIGUOUS, INTENT(OUT) :: msgin(:)
!! Received data
INTEGER, CONTIGUOUS, INTENT(IN) :: rcount(:, :), rdispl(:, :)
TYPE(mp_comm_type), INTENT(IN) :: gid
!! Size of sent data for every process
!! Offset of sent data for every process
!! Message passing environment identifier
TYPE(mp_request_type), INTENT(INOUT) :: request
CHARACTER(LEN=*), PARAMETER :: routineN = 'mp_iallgatherv_iv2'
INTEGER :: handle, ierr
#if defined(__parallel)
INTEGER :: scount, rsize
#endif
ierr = 0
CALL timeset(routineN, handle)
#if defined(__parallel)
scount = SIZE(msgout)
rsize = SIZE(rcount)
CALL mp_iallgatherv_iv_internal(msgout, scount, msgin, rsize, rcount, &
rdispl, gid, request, ierr)
IF (ierr /= 0) CALL mp_stop(ierr, "mpi_iallgatherv @ "//routineN)
#else
MARK_USED(rcount)
MARK_USED(rdispl)
MARK_USED(gid)
msgin = msgout
request = mp_request_null
#endif
CALL timestop(handle)
END SUBROUTINE mp_iallgatherv_iv2
